Vulnerability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in GeoClassifieds Enterprise 2.0.5.2 and earlier all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script and HTML via the (1) b[username] and (2) c parameters to (a) index.php, the b[username] parameter to (b) admin/index.php, and (3) c[phone] parameter to register.php.
